HellHeart Breaker is a new roguelite game from the creators of Cuisineer, mixing dungeon crawling with dating simulation

Remember the cooking-themed roguelite Cuisineer, where you ran a restaurant and ventured into dungeons to gather ingredients? The same developers BattleBrew Productions have recently announced their new project HellHeart Breaker. It’s a game that combines action roguelite mechanics with a dating simulator, and it’s planned to release in the first quarter of 2027 on PC via Steam. So, we’ll have to wait quite a while.

The core of the game lies in its hybrid approach: you build romantic relationships with seven monstrous girls who grant you various powers, but those who reject you become bosses you must fight. The game offers a diverse arsenal of 35 weapons, plus seven elemental ability trees and numerous upgrades that further shape your playstyle.

Beyond combat, HellHeart Breaker includes customization features like clothing and home decorating, letting you personalize your experience. A quirky addition is fishing, which brings a relaxing element. On the other hand, the Kappa Market offers an abundance of food, echoing Cuisineer’s culinary charm. The studio jokingly emphasizes that despite the romantic aspect, players “can’t fix” all of their companions.
